Analysis

Haiti recorded 30.9% for survival rate to the last grade of primary education, male in 1985.

That represents a change of up 92.8% on the previous year and down 10.1% over ten years.

That places Haiti 160th out of 164 countries with data for 1985, putting it in the bottom quarter.

Haiti compared with similar countries

  • Haiti's 30.9% is below the median for lower middle income countries, which is 73.9%, 42% of the median. (44 countries reporting)
  • Haiti's 30.9% is below the median for Latin America & Caribbean, which is 89.3%, 35% of the median. (28 countries reporting)
